Esto puede parecer una pregunta descabellada, pero ¿hay algo en Fedora 16/17 que elimine imágenes .jpg de /tmp/?
Tenía 4 GB de imágenes almacenadas en /tmp/download y ya no están. La estructura de carpetas sigue ahí, pero todas las carpetas están vacías.
Y lo loco es que es la segunda vez que me pasa esto. Ambas veces desde /tmp/download.
Mi sistema de archivos parece estar bien (ejecutando raid-1) y no falta ningún otro archivo.
Entonces, ¿soy yo quien eliminó los archivos y los olvidó, o es Fedora?
Respuesta1
Hay un trabajo de limpieza en /etc/cron.daily/tmpwatch que destruirá archivos a los que no se ha accedido por un tiempo (30 días de forma predeterminada).
man 8 tmpwatch
podría dar más información
Respuesta2
A partir de Fedora 18, /tmp
se monta tmpfs
(es decir, RAM) de forma predeterminada y, por lo tanto, se borra al apagar.
Este comportamiento se puede deshabilitar al emitir systemctl mask tmp.mount
y reiniciar (y volver a habilitar al emitir systemctl unmask tmp.mount
y reiniciar), y luego /tmp
se montará en el /
sistema de archivos y se podrá controlar mediante /usr/lib/tmpfiles.d/tmp.conf
la configuración.
Verhttp://fedoraproject.org/wiki/Features/tmp-on-tmpfsy man tmpfiles.d
para más detalles sobre cada caso.